Stay : LAKE MBURO CAMPING SAFARI

This 3-day safari to Lake Mburo takes you to one of Uganda's most beautiful savannah parks, Lake Mburo National Park, home to 350 species of birds as well as zebra, impala, eland, buffalo, oribi, Defassa cob, leopard, hippo, hyena, topi and reedbuck. Lake Mburo is magical in its own way, with its striking sunsets and the diversity of its scenic landscapes, which range from savannah vegetation to forests, seasonal and permanent swamps, making it a habitat for many species of animals and birds.

Day 1: Arrival and transfer - Lake Mburo National Park

Steps: Lake Mburo National Park

On arrival in Uganda, you'll be met and picked up by our driver/guide at Entebbe International Airport, given a brief safari briefing and immediately boarded for your road transfer to Lake Mburo National Park. You'll have lunch en route and pass through the Ugandan Equator to see where this imaginary line divides our planet into two equal hemispheres.

On arrival at the park, you'll settle into your lodge and spend the rest of the day relaxing. If you arrive early, you'll go on an afternoon game drive to observe various mammal species such as impala, zebra, giraffe, buffalo and many more.

Day 2: Morning walking safari and afternoon boat trip

Steps: Lake Mburo National Park

After breakfast, you'll take a walking safari in the park to observe the various species of mammals and birds you may have missed on the evening excursion. Return to the lodge for lunch and prepare for the boat cruise, one of the park's most memorable experiences. Over 300 hippos live in the lake. You'll have the pleasure of observing various water birds and their sweet sounds, as well as animals such as hippos, crocodiles, water pigs, buffalo, etc.

Day 3: Optional cycling safari and transfer, en route Equator Experience in Uganda

Steps: Lake Mburo National Park

After an early breakfast, you'll depart for the optional morning experience outside the park, in the communities, on a bicycle and, after this experience, you'll begin your journey to the airport. En route, you'll stop at the Equator for a photo, snacks and souvenirs.

You will then continue your journey to Entebbe airport for your return flight.
